#1d1bfd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d1bfd is composed of 11.4% red, 10.6%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.5% cyan, 89.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 240.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 54.9%. #1d1bfd color hex could be obtained by blending #3a36ff with #0000fb.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#1d1bfd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000005 is the darkest color, while #f1f1ff is the lightest one.
